What to Eat? WHAT TO EAT???
It is recommended that the participants carb-up 3 to 4 hrs
prior to working out. Pasta, bread, raisins, bananas, oat
meal, sports bars etc are good . Stay away from high sugar
items like candy bars, chocolate, etc as these give a brief
rise in energy levels followed by a drastic crash. They will
not enhance performance. Do Not Eat within one hour of
working out!!! A high carb snack is a good idea
immediately after working out (within the first 20 min)
followed by a high carb meal to replace the glycogen
stores.

What to drink?        
Come well hydrated. You can never drink enough water. It
takes water approximately 45 min for water to get into the
system which then eliminates about 75% of what is
consumed.

Try to drink 6 large glasses of water starting approximately 4
hrs before the work out & continuing up to work out time. By
constantly drinking water, the blood thins & is able to more
readily eliminate lactic acid build-up (causes fatigue &
muscle failure). It is easier on the heart as well!
